Master control system realizes redundancy and signal inspection to two tachometer signals of impeller and generator in megawatt-level wind unit
Look into.Referring to the drawings shown in 1, the rotating speed of impeller is measured by the incremental rotary encoder installed in slip ring rear end, measured
Signal be directly inputted to hypervelocity module, hypervelocity module can set the limit value that triggering exceeds the speed limit, while the module that exceeds the speed limit is by the rotating speed
Signal is input to master control system, is used as the Redundant Control of rotating speed;The rotating speed of generator passes through installed in generator amature rear end
Incremental rotary encoder is measured, measured signal be input to converter control system be used for realize control to generator
System, while the tach signal is transferred to master control system by converter control system by way of bus communication again.It is soft in control
The limit value of overspeed protection is set in part program, and the limit value will be less than hypervelocity module acceleration alert value.When blower fan hypervelocity, and rotating speed
During more than this limit value, wind-driven generator has two separate systems to carry out the rotation of termination machine rotor, to prevent from surpassing
Speed, triggers the limit value of controller in master control system first, and controller quotes software hypervelocity failure, quick shutdown;Work as controller
During alarm failure, hypervelocity module says the word to controller, while triggering theft-resistant link chain, starting emergency shutdown order makes blower fan stop rotation
Turn.
Scene carries out the hypervelocity test of megawatt-level wind unit at present, be by reduce hypervelocity module triggering hypervelocity limit value or
By the way that slip ring is pulled down from gear-box, slip ring is rotated, makes rotating speed more than 20rpm Times hypervelocity failure, it is actual not go to
20rpm, current this method of testing can only deserve to be called simulation test, it is impossible to which test is extreme to the actual hypervelocity of Wind turbines
Operating mode, it is impossible to verify whether wind turbine transmission chain disclosure satisfy that hypervelocity to 20rpm requirement, therefore existing method of testing is present
Defect.

Referring to the drawings shown in 2, Wind turbines overspeed test method of testing of the present invention, specific testing procedure is as follows:
1st, it is in Wind turbines under maintenance state, confirms whether the work of paddle change system of wind turbines back-up source is normal,
If normal, start test;If abnormal, need to be investigated, the row test again after Resolving probiems;
2nd, hypervelocity module wiring is checked, confirms that hypervelocity module sets alarming value to be 20rpm;
3rd, simulation test:Slip ring is pulled down from gear-box, slip ring is rotated, makes its rotating speed more than 20rpm, Wind turbines report
It has software hypervelocity failure and theft-resistant link chain hypervelocity failure, confirms that the primary control program hypervelocity limit value in controller is set and theft-resistant link chain module
Overspeed detection function is normal;
4th, slip ring is reinstalled on gear-box, be revised as rotational speed setup limit value by 18rpm in primary control program
20.5rpm, shields the hypervelocity failure function of current transformer, and forbids the grid-connected function of Wind turbines to open, and 4-8m/s is in wind speed
Period, Wind turbines is dallied, Wind turbines rotational speed limit is stepped up, when the impeller that rotating speed reaches primary control program surpasses
Speed is when judging limit value 19.5rpm, and primary control program, which quotes software rotating speed, to transfinite failure, Wind turbines quick shutdown;Again by master control journey
The hypervelocity of sequence judges that limit value is revised as 20.5rpm by 19.5rpm, under same precondition, is again started up blower fan and carries out sky
Turn, when rotating speed reaches 20rpm, theft-resistant link chain module quotes hypervelocity failure, triggering theft-resistant link chain action, Wind turbines emergency shutdown.
Above-mentioned method of testing not only demonstrates primary control program hypervelocity limit value setting and theft-resistant link chain module overspeed detection function
Validity, while also demonstrating whole wind turbine transmission chain disclosure satisfy that hypervelocity to 20rpm requirement, and being capable of safe stopping
Machine.
